摘要: 采用胴体重(去除内脏的体重, 记为WN ,) 替代传统计算公式中的体重(W) 建立肥满度指标K′= 100 WN/L3 (g/cm3 ) 对长爪沙鼠肥满度的年龄和季节变化特征进行研究。结果显示: 该鼠肥满度年龄组间差异显著, 未成年个体的肥满度明显高于成年个体; 各性别年龄组肥满度季节变化明显, 趋势基本一致, 春季高、夏季最低、秋季又行育肥。在春夏季繁殖期(8 月以前), 雌鼠的肥满度大于雄鼠。成年雌鼠秋季育肥时间晚于其他个体组。长爪沙鼠肥满度的年龄差异和季节变化反映了该鼠在不同生活时期对环境的生理适应特征和对策。此外, 各月肥满度与当月及其后第4 个月的夹捕率存在一定的相关关系, 提示该指标在短期预测长爪沙鼠种群数量方面可能有其参考价值。

Abstract: Relative fatness is an important general indicator of physiological body condition of small mammals and reflects their adaptive ability to the environment. The relative fatness of Mongolian gerbils ( Meriones unguiculatus) was studied from March to November 1997 in TaiPuSi Banner, Inner Mongolian in China. It was calculated by the formula : K′= 100WN/L3 (g/cm3 ), where L indicated the naso-anal length , and WN was the carcass body weight minus all internal organs. The removal of all internal organs is to exclude the possible ones caused by the weight of food in digestive canal , embryos or pregnancy and sexual organs. Results indicated that the relative fatness changed significantly with age which relative fatness of sub-adult individuals was significantly higher than that of adult ones. Its seasonal changes of different sexual age groups were in accordance with this rule : relative fatness of rodents becomes high in spring , lowest in summer and fatted again in autumn in high altitude zones. Our results indicated that the relative fatness of the female was higher than that of the male before August ; and the relative fatness of the sub-adult and adult male groups were fatted until September or October , while that of the female group fatted until November. Combined with the life-history characteristics , it was concluded that Mongolian gerbils adjusted its hysiological conditions to adapt to the environment in different life stages. In addition , the monthly relative fatness in males negatively correlated to its monthly population relative size , and relative fatness in the adults had a significant positive correlation with the population size 4-month later. Our results indicated that using relative fatness as an indicator in forecasting relative size of population in Mongolian gerbils has its reference value.
